An instrument has been constructed to measure the density of an air stream by utilizing the reduction in intensity of an undeviated beam of x-rays. This equipment has been designed for density ranges from 0.00002 to 0.0003 grams per cubic centimeter. Path-length-density products were measured within 0.00005 g/cm sq. for x-ray beam areas of 0.0005 cm sq. and averaging time of 30 seconds, and within 0.0001 g/cm sq. for beam areas of 0.008 cm sq. and averaging times of 5 minutes.
